1.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is division?
Back
Division is the process of splitting a number into equal parts. It tells us how many times one number is contained within another.
2.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What does a remainder mean in division?
Back
A remainder is the amount left over after division when one number cannot be divided evenly by another.
3.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
If you have 18 kids and want to seat them at tables for 4, how do you find out how many tables you need?
Back
You divide 18 by 4. The answer is 4 with a remainder of 2, meaning you need 5 tables.
